x86: construct static part of 1:1 mapping at build time
... rather than at boot time, removing unnecessary redundancy between EFI and legacy boot code. Signed-off-by: Jan Beulich <jbeulich@suse.com> Acked-by: Keir Fraser <keir@xen.org>
